It&#8217;s quite unique in that its one of the few Bearbricks that have different designs for each half of the Bearbrick&#8217;s body, with one half showing the exterior of the Companions and the other being a &#8220;dissected&#8221; half, showing their internal organs. Three colors currently exist: Black, Brown, and Grey, with their 1000% versions going anywhere between $9,000 to $14,000.<\/p>\n<div style=\"margin-bottom: 30px;\"><a style=\"display: block; max-width: 700px; text-decoration: none; text-align: center; background-color: #e64946; color: #fff; font-size: 1.2em; padding: 7px; margin: 0 auto;\" href=\"https:\/\/www.fromjapan.co.jp\/japan\/en\/item\/search\/KAWS+bearbrick\/Al_11_Yh_RaSuBpOmRm_N_N_0A00ja00_N\/lgk-link_top_search?utm_source=BlogEn&amp;utm_medium=BlogEn_post&amp;utm_campaign=BlogEn_post_221117RarestBearbrickKAWS_en&amp;utm_term=221117RarestBearbrickKAWS_en#argument=mSgXHiXn&amp;ai=a637616df0ddc9\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">Search for KAWS x Bearbrick from Japan<\/a><\/div>\n<h3>Coco Chanel 1000% Bearbrick<\/h3>\n<p><center><img src=\"https:\/\/blog.fromjapan.co.jp\/en\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/01\/Chanel-1000-Bearbrick.png\" \/><\/center>Renowned French fashion designer Coco Chanel was immortalized by another renowned designer, Karl Lagerfield, in her very own Bearbrick for a charity auction in 2007. The result is this unique Bearbrick patterned after her likeness.<\/p>\n<p>Due to it being produced for a one-time event and never remade again, the <strong>Coco Chanel 1000% Bearbrick<\/strong> is hard to come by in markets and auctions. Its rarity is reflected in its price too &#8212; it&#8217;s been steadily going up over the years, and is currently valued online at $74,999! BAPE are known for their camo patterns which can be seen all over the Bearbrick&#8217;s design, and for their shark motif which is featured on one half of the Bearbrick&#8217;s face. The icon of mastermind, on the other hand, is their skull and crossbones symbol which you can see as the other half of the face.<\/p>\n<p>The two color versions are valued at different prices, with the <strong>Green Camo<\/strong> version ($4,774) being more than twice the price of the <strong>Yellow<\/strong> version ($2,208).<\/p>\n<div style=\"margin-bottom: 30px;\"><a style=\"display: block; max-width: 700px; text-decoration: none; text-align: center; background-color: #e64946; color: #fff; font-size: 1.2em; padding: 7px; margin: 0 auto;\" href=\"https:\/\/www.fromjapan.co.jp\/japan\/en\/item\/search\/bearbrick+bape+mastermind\/Al_11_Yh_RaSuBpOmRm_N_N_0A00ja00_N\/lgk-link_top_search?utm_source=BlogEn&amp;utm_medium=BlogEn_post&amp;utm_campaign=BlogEn_post_221117RarestBearbrickMastermind_en&amp;utm_term=221117RarestBearbrickMastermind_en#argument=mSgXHiXn&amp;ai=a63761ac129a51\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">Search for Bearbrick BAPE x Mastermind from Japan<\/a><\/div>\n<h3>Emotionally Unavailable 1000% Bearbrick (Red Heart)<\/h3>\n<p><center><img src=\"https:\/\/blog.fromjapan.co.jp\/en\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/01\/Emotionally-Unavailable-1000-Bearbrick-Red-Heart.png\" \/><\/center>While this Bearbrick is one of the more recent ones on this list, it&#8217;s still one of the rarest and most valued Bearbrick collaborations out there. Emotionally Unavailable is a clothing brand by Edison Chen and Kybum Lee, and the <strong>Emotionally Unavailable 1000% Bearbrick<\/strong> was released in 2020 in Shibuya, Tokyo. The heart inside the Bearbrick lights up as well, making it one-of-a-kind. The Red Heart versions go from $1,700 (the leftmost Bearbrick in the image), and can go as high as $9,556 for the Clear version.<\/p>\n<div style=\"margin-bottom: 30px;\"><a style=\"display: block; max-width: 700px; text-decoration: none; text-align: center; background-color: #e64946; color: #fff; font-size: 1.2em; padding: 7px; margin: 0 auto;\" href=\"https:\/\/www.fromjapan.co.jp\/japan\/en\/item\/search\/emotionally+unavailable+bearbrick\/Al_11_Yh_RaSuBpOmRm_N_N_0A00ja00_N\/lgk-link_top_search?utm_source=BlogEn&amp;utm_medium=BlogEn_post&amp;utm_campaign=BlogEn_post_221117RarestBearbrickEmotionally_en&amp;utm_term=221117RarestBearbrickEmotionally_en#argument=mSgXHiXn&amp;ai=a63761a4c6b68b\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">Search for Bearbrick x Emotionally Unavailable from Japan<\/a><\/div>\n<h3>KAWS \u201cChompers\u201d Bearbrick 1000%<\/h3>\n<p><center><img src=\"https:\/\/blog.fromjapan.co.jp\/en\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/01\/KAWS-Chompers-Be@rbrick-1000.png\" \/><\/center>Next, we have another entry from a Bearbrick and KAWS collaboration, but this time, we&#8217;ll be talking about one of their earliest collaborations dating back from 2003. The <strong>KAWS \u201cChompers\u201d Bearbrick 1000%<\/strong> features KAWS&#8217; signature character designs through the bright blue figure with a wide open mouth and exposed teeth, which is what the &#8220;chompers&#8221; portion of the name refers to. Because it had a limited release from almost 20 years ago, the 1000% Bearbrick is currently valued on sites abroad at around $18,500.<\/p>\n<div style=\"margin-bottom: 30px;\"><a style=\"display: block; max-width: 700px; text-decoration: none; text-align: center; background-color: #e64946; color: #fff; font-size: 1.2em; padding: 7px; margin: 0 auto;\" href=\"https:\/\/www.fromjapan.co.jp\/japan\/en\/item\/search\/chompers+bearbrick\/Al_11_Yh_RaSuBpOmRm_N_N_0A00ja00_N\/lgk-link_top_search?utm_source=BlogEn&amp;utm_medium=BlogEn_post&amp;utm_campaign=BlogEn_post_221117RarestBearbrickChompers_en&amp;utm_term=221117RarestBearbrickChompers_en#argument=mSgXHiXn&amp;ai=a63761a06e7c67\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">Search for Bearbrick x KAWS Chompers from Japan<\/a><\/div>\n<h3>Bearbrick x Keith Haring Collection<\/h3>\n<p><center><img src=\"https:\/\/blog.fromjapan.co.jp\/en\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/01\/Keith-Haring-x-Bearbrick.png\" \/><\/center>American artist <strong>Keith Haring<\/strong> was so influential in the pop art world that more than 30 years after his death, his work can still be seen everywhere. The first is a graffiti known as &#8220;<strong>Flower Bomber<\/strong>&#8221; or &#8220;<strong>Flower Thrower<\/strong>&#8220;, which depicts a masked man in a pose about to throw a colored bouquet of flowers. The other Banksy artwork featured here is &#8220;<strong>Flying Balloon Girl<\/strong>&#8220;, which depicts a young girl holding on to balloons as she starts to fly away. Both graffiti pieces have been used as patterns for the Bearbrick designs, and prices for them range between $400 up to $1000.<\/p>\n<div style=\"margin-bottom: 30px;\"><a style=\"display: block; max-width: 700px; text-decoration: none; text-align: center; background-color: #e64946; color: #fff; font-size: 1.2em; padding: 7px; margin: 0 auto;\" href=\"https:\/\/www.fromjapan.co.jp\/japan\/en\/item\/search\/bearbrick+banksy\/Al_11_Yh_RaSuBpOmRm_N_N_0A00ja00_N\/lgk-link_top_search?utm_source=BlogEn&amp;utm_medium=BlogEn_post&amp;utm_campaign=BlogEn_post_221117RarestBearbrickBanksy_en&amp;utm_term=221117RarestBearbrickBanksy_en#argument=mSgXHiXn&amp;ai=a6376190c38f93&quot;\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">Search for Banksy x Bearbrick from Japan<\/a><\/div>\n<h3>Karimoku 1000% Bearbrick<\/h3>\n<p><center><img src=\"https:\/\/blog.fromjapan.co.jp\/en\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/01\/Karimoku-1000-Bearbrick.png\" \/><\/center><strong>Karimoku<\/strong> is a high-end Japanese furniture store that specializes in wooden furniture. In Japan, they&#8217;re known for the quality of their products which are straightforward in design, but will last in your home for a long time.<\/p>\n<p>The <strong>Karimoku Bearbrick collaboration<\/strong> is to date, the only one of its kind to be produced. So far, there hasn&#8217;t been other designs that make use of the beauty of natural wood, and the 1000% version of this collection has five unique styles.<\/p>\n<p>Some of the 1000% versions were only made available during certain events, such as the <strong>BE@RBRICK Worldwide Tour 2 Karimoku 1000%<\/strong> ($4600) and the <strong>BE@RBRICK Karimoku Walnut 1000%<\/strong> ($5530) from the Medicom Toy Exhibition 2013. These prices aren&#8217;t unusual either &#8212; the lowest original distribution price for a Bearbrick Karimoku 1000% is \u00a5525,000 or $4600!<\/p>\n<div style=\"margin-bottom: 30px;\"><a style=\"display: block; max-width: 700px; text-decoration: none; text-align: center; background-color: #e64946; color: #fff; font-size: 1.2em; padding: 7px; margin: 0 auto;\" href=\"https:\/\/www.fromjapan.co.jp\/japan\/en\/item\/search\/bearbrick+%E3%82%AB%E3%83%AA%E3%83%A2%E3%82%AF\/Al_11_Yh_RaSuBpOmRm_N_N_0A00ja00_N\/lgk-link_top_search?utm_source=BlogEn&amp;utm_medium=BlogEn_post&amp;utm_campaign=BlogEn_post_221117RarestBearbrickKarimoku_en&amp;utm_term=221117RarestBearbrickKarimoku_en#argument=mSgXHiXn&amp;ai=a637618b6f0060\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">Search for Karimoku x Bearbrick from Japan<\/a><\/div>\n<h3>Bearbrick Evangelion Unit Set of 3<\/h3>\n<p><center><img src=\"https:\/\/blog.fromjapan.co.jp\/en\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/01\/Bearbrick-Evangelion-Unit-Set-of-3.png\" \/><\/center>The Bearbrick Evangelion collaboration is only one of dozens of Beabrick anime collaborations that have happened over the years.
